Did my nails last week but my shellac is really chipping on the acrylic free edge and I don't know why?? I capped the free edge so I know it's not that.. could it be my shellac was too thick, it is a new colour (tinted love) and it basically covered in one coat but did two as I always do. I'm new to acrylics so unsure what I have done wrong?? can anyone help? Thanks :) x

Anyhow Lorrainiac this is common with any gel polish over acrylics as the wear off per say is down to each client and how they use their nails. I do however think your acrylic is applied too thick to be honest they not meant to be thicker then a credit card thickness which could also be why wear off is faster on this set.
The colour I usually apply and just before curing I run my finger or brush across free edge to wipe the colour from the tip but apply the topcoat all way over. So colours isn't as intense and less likely to chip as buildup of product is less so when client bumps range free edge there less to come off.

Try this again on yourself but try making acrylic thinner and then apply your gel polish and see if that helps

All I was pointing out is shellac was originally designed for use on natural nails for people who don't want false/acrylic nails. However when used on acrylics remember you don't need a base coat just buff the acrylic nail slightly first so the colour adheres - sorry if I make no sense only trying to help
